Core features include multi-standard modeling capabilities encompassing widely used frameworks such as UML, BPMN, SysML, and ArchiMate, allowing users to work seamlessly across different modeling standards. It offers comprehensive diagramming options with over 50 different diagram types available, providing extensive flexibility to visualize complex systems effectively. The tool supports detailed requirements management with full traceability, ensuring that all requirements are linked and tracked throughout the project lifecycle. Additionally, it provides both forward and reverse code engineering, enabling users to generate code from models and create models from existing code bases. Impact analysis tools help assess the effects of changes across the system, while automated documentation and reporting features streamline the creation of detailed project documentation. Collaboration is enhanced through integrated version control, supporting multi-user environments for concurrent teamwork. The platform is also highly extensible, offering scripting capabilities and add-in support to customize and expand its functionality. It is designed to handle large-scale, multi-user repositories efficiently and offers integration with various development environments and other enterprise tools to support comprehensive software development processes.
